Hofer Symphoniker

The Hofer Symphoniker a symphony orchestra in the region of Upper Franconia. Established in 1945 the orchestra has its headquarters in Hof an der Saale. It consists of 62 musicians from 19 nations. The Hofer Symphoniker understood as a cultural and education companies and are carried in the form of a gGmbH since 1 January 2007. Under its umbrella, they combine a wide range of musical, social and educational projects that have made the Hofer Symphoniker into a cultural center of the region.

Business

Since its foundation in 1945, the Hofer Symphoniker have grown steadily, founded next to the orchestra area, a music school, a Suzuki Academy and an art school and cooperate with mainstream schools and kindergartens. Thus they are anchored in the city life. The music school of the Hofer Symphoniker was founded in 1978. The overall management of the institution had 1965-2008 Wilfried Anton. Since 1 January 2009, Ingrid Schrader director and CEO of the Hofer Symphoniker.

History

In 1945, conductor Charles F. Keller, Hofer Symphoniker under the name Hofer concert orchestra. The musicians came primarily from the Sudetenland; some local musicians complemented the orchestra. From 1965 director had A.D. Wilfried Anton responsibility for the orchestra. In its early years, the Hofer Symphoniker were mainly a theater orchestra. Being familiar with theater services, however, could not alone ensure their existence, they were also known as spa orchestra in Bad Steben, Bad Kissingen (see: Bad Kissingen Spa Orchestra ) and bathroom Booklet on. 1953 had the Hofer Symphoniker still posts a thickness of 40 musicians. By 1979, they increased exceedingly, and raised their quality, so that they could take out a whole year's game operating as a theater and symphony orchestra in northern Bavaria. Appearances in the spas were no longer needed and were therefore discontinued. In 1978, the Hofer Symphoniker orchestra, a music school, to this day the only one in Germany. Thus, the development of cultural and educational enterprise began.

Concerts

The Hofer Symphoniker are primarily an orchestra that occurs in farm and in the region of Upper Franconia. Besides the 65 concerts each year the Hofer Symphoniker singers such as José Carreras and Lucia Aliberti accompanied at the Thurn-und- Taxis- Festival in Regensburg. Instrumentalists like Hilary Hahn, Julia Fischer, Peter Sadlo, Bruno Leonardo Gelber, Daniel Hope or Dmitri Sitkovetsky occurred with the Hofer Symphoniker. Guest performances the orchestra in the great concert halls of Germany, as in the Gewandhaus Leipzig at the opening of Book Fair 2004, the Alte Oper Frankfurt and the Konzerthaus am Gendarmenmarkt in Berlin. In November 2005, the Hofer Symphoniker were seen in the ZDF broadcast a big night music with Götz Alsmann. The Hofer Symphoniker are also active in the field of popular music and performed with Joja Wendt, Quadro Nuevo, and with the rock band Radspitz. The repertoire includes works from film, Rock, Classic, Pop and Jazz. The Hofer Symphoniker cooperate closely with the theater courtyard. After the contract for work they perform 54 percent of the tariff legally possible Orchestra services for the design of musical theater (opera, operetta, musical, ballet ) at the theater courtyard. This cooperation is economical for both partners.

School of Music

The Hofer Symphoniker are the only orchestra in Germany, which operates a music school. The students are taught in all instruments which are used in symphony orchestras, of Orchestra 's musicians. Many students have already been awarded for Youth Music and the German accordion soloists Music Prize. In addition to the classical instruments modern instruments such as rock guitar, electric bass, rock-pop vocals, saxophone, folk and vocal music and music education are taught. Particularly good students have the opportunity to appear with the orchestra Hofer Symphoniker and to attend a special class to prepare for studying at a music school.

The Hofer Model

In the region courtyard there for over 30 years, a symbiosis between the professional orchestra and the orchestra 's music school, which is called Hofer Model: The musicians of the Symphony Orchestra are also working as teachers of their own music school. For Hofer model also includes special teaching methods and models of cooperation:

  • Music and Dramatic branch at Jean -Paul High School courtyard ( with credit course music) since 1994 and of arts branch at the secondary school Naila since the beginning of the school year 2009/10. The collaboration with the school and the secondary school is unique in Germany in its way, because the instrumental instruction is issued by the Hofer Symphoniker, the concerts are held together and the Youth Symphony Orchestra jointly.
  • Bläserklassen and Symphonic Concert at the Schiller -Gymnasium court
  • Life - cycle: percussion class at the school yard Sophie ( primary and secondary school) as a musical and social project in a deprived area of the city
  • Intergenerational music in collaboration with a nursery and a nursing home in Helmbrechts
  • Musical education and instrumental beginning teaching in primary schools
  • Concert events for children and parents; Music education as a family experience
  • Performance opportunities for winners and prize-winners of the annual Young Musicians competitions, partly as a grant from the Hofer Symphoniker solo in subscription and symphony concerts

Suzuki Academy

In early instrumental music lessons the Hofer Symphoniker insert the Suzuki method. It is a special form of instrumental lessons for children from three years and matched to the learning process of children. Since 1994, the Suzuki Department at the Music School of the Hofer Symphoniker, the eV in cooperation with the German Society Suzuki also a music teacher to Suzuki teachers continues to form. The Susuki Academy of the Hofer Symphoniker is now the largest of its kind at a German music school with around 100 children, who are taught by nine Suzuki teachers. Published every two years since 1999, the Bavarian Suzuki days in court are held. You are a great international workshop for Suzuki students and teachers and all who are interested in the Suzuki method. The Suzuki Academy of Hofer Symphoniker is unique in Germany with its educational mission for children and young people and their training and qualifications for the adults in this form.

Art School

In 1982, an art school was affiliated at that time still under the name of art school. This ensures that support, who wish to operate in the visual arts environment. This concept of interdisciplinary work within a home has proven itself and is practiced in a similar form elsewhere. Today about 60 pupils receive from first-graders to the pensioner lessons in painting and drawing courses in the Children's Art I, II, III, Youth Art I and in course times in the morning. The instructors are trained art teachers or qualified designer. In five to seven exhibitions a year, students present their work to the public.

Competitions

International Violin Competition Henri Marteau

The International Violin Competition Henri Marteau in Lichtenberg takes place in three annual cycle in the house Marteau. 2002 eV launched by the Friends of Music Meeting House Marteau, 2007, the district of Upper Franconia has taken over the sponsorship of the competition together with the Hofer Symphoniker. With the overall guidance of the cultural and educational enterprise Hofer Symphoniker was entrusted.

Regional Competition " Young Musicians "

An important and effective tool for youth development is the competition " Young Musicians ". The regional competition " Young Musicians " for the counties yard and Wunsiedel is organized by the cultural and educational enterprise Hofer Symphoniker since 2008. Every year the regional competition in one of the two counties held each at a different location.

"Piano beyond borders " - German - Czech competition for four-hand piano

In November 2002, the cultural and educational enterprise Hofer Symphoniker organized the first German - Czech competition for four-handed piano playing " Piano over borders ." After a Czech and a German national round of the International Finals followed. The competition has since been aligned in three annual basis.

Scientific Projects

" A different tone - The Hofer Model "

A musical education is the ideal start to a fulfilling life for children. This finding is the conclusion of a scientific study, the internationally renowned brain researcher Professor Ernst Poppel with musicologist Professor Lorenz Welker has performed at the Ludwig- Maximilians- University of Munich on behalf of the cultural and educational enterprise Hofer Symphoniker. In the study for the first time by means of psychological tests and standardized measurement methods ( magnetic resonance tomography ) could be demonstrated that learning an instrument and making music together to create the best conditions for young people to grow up to be mentally and emotionally mature people. The study has also shown to have developed much better at music students memory, attention, intelligence, achievement motivation and social behavior than non- music-making peers. From the results of the investigation and innovative solutions for many social problems can be previously underrated transfer effects derived that are not only give the school and education system new ideas, but in addition offer.

Foundation Hofer Symphoniker

In December 1999, the Foundation was established Hofer Symphoniker. She is the first foundation in Germany, which operates exclusively for the benefit of an orchestra. Early reacted so the cultural and educational enterprise Hofer Symphoniker on the increasingly difficult financial situation of the public sector. The Foundation Hofer Symphoniker is a new way, in the long term to ensure the existence of the company culture. It offers the economy and the citizenry the opportunity to increase, a large and important cultural institution in their home city and its region.

Awards

  • German President Johannes Rau in 2004 honored the youth work of the Hofer Symphoniker orchestra and its own music school with the price Inventio 2004.
  • In 2005, the Hofer Symphoniker received an award from the National Initiative Germany - Land of Ideas as a representative of the 365 Landmarks in the Land of Ideas. The Hofer Symphoniker are thus exemplary of outstanding ideas in Germany.
  • In 2006, awarded the Academy of Fine Arts in Munich, the Friedrich- Baur- Award 2006 for Music goes to the Hofer Symphoniker.
  • On 17 October 2010, the cultural and educational enterprise Hofer Symphoniker was honored with ECHO Classic with the Special Jury Prize for young talent in the field of classical music.
  • In November 2010, the cultural and educational enterprise Hofer Symphoniker received the Culture Prize 2010 of the Bavarian Foundation.
